When and where do ticks mate and reproduce on my dog or cat?

The female tick falls off the host (dog, cat, person) after it is full of blood to lay their eggs. The male and female mate ON the host. Depending on the tick species the full life cycle takes 2 months to complete. The females tend to lay the eggs in the spring and the larva feed and molt and turn to nymphs during late summer. Nymphs are inactive during the winter and start feeding again in the Spring. Then they molt in to adults through the summer months. They spend the fall feeding and breeding. males die off and females survive through the winter to lay their eggs the following spring.
